- ZATCA proposes tax law amendments on Istitlaa platform in KSA
- ZATCA published additional rules on tax refunds for eligible real estate developers
- The rules allow for the recovery of VAT on properties with suspended construction
- The proposals are open for public consultation on the Istitlaa platform.
